Czech Republic - Employment in Basic Metals
Since 2014, Czech Republic Employment in Basic Metals was down by 0% year on year. With 46.59 Thousand Full-Time Equivalent in 2019, the country was ranked number 4 among other countries in Employment in Basic Metals. Czech Republic is overtaken by France, which was ranked number 3 with 71 Thousand Full-Time Equivalent and is followed by Austria with 36.33 Thousand Full-Time Equivalent. South Korea lead the ranking with 140.6 Thousand Full-Time Equivalent in 2018, that is -1.2% compared to 2017. Norway witnessed the best average annual growth at +1.8% per year, while South Korea was the worst growing country at -4.3% per year.
